Experimental method

    • Aim
      • a general statement about what the research intends to investigate
    • Variables
      independent = what is being changed
      dependant = what is being measured
    • Operationalisation
      clearly defining variables in terms of how they can be measured
    • Experimental groups
      the group of which something is changed
    • Control group
      the group which is not exposed to the experimental treatment
    • Extraneous Variables
      nuisance variables that can often be controlled before an experiment, such as temperature or time of day
    • Confounding Variables
      • Any variable other than the IV which impacts the DV
      • researchers are often unaware that confounding variables are going to influence results until after the study
      • cant be prevented from impacting the DV
    • Directional hypothesis
      • IV will have impact on the DV
      • research has been completed before
    • Non directional Hypothesis
      • IV will have a general effect on the DV
      • research has not been done before
      • "there will be a difference...."
    • Null hypothesis
      • IV will not have an effect on DV
      • "there will be no difference...."
